Output 756fbfbfc608bb10c7bf823e72b6b750dc7a083cb9972c1005863cbda17a8ef1:5

value
16440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59028400e3ed472c8b9fa4cf735df9cd93f77094 OP_EQUAL
address
39of5QX2ZRwf5qCAnzhHAiLGhfcuREUNYD
transaction
756fbfbfc608bb10c7bf823e72b6b750dc7a083cb9972c1005863cbda17a8ef1
spent
true